
Neftalí Ruiz
Monseñor Neftalí Ruiz is a member of the Ancient Catholic Church and an advocate for social justice in El Salvador. He has actively participated in the Movimiento Nacional Voces del Futuro, calling for the repeal of the General Mining Law due to its potential environmental harms. Ruiz emphasizes the importance of supporting community movements and addressing the needs of the people, aligning with the teachings of Pope Francis on pastoral care and social responsibility.
